What Most Buyers Get Wrong
Sizing Up Your Sink for the Perfect Fit
Before buying, accurately measure your sink opening. Roll-up racks need to span the width or depth of your sink to rest securely. Look for specific dimensions like those from Tomorotec (offering 17.7 x 12.5in, 17.7 x 15.5in, and 21 x 15.5in options) or Surpahs (17.5 x 13.1 Inch, fitting sink openings up to 16.5 inches).
Miscalculating can lead to a rack that’s too small to be stable or too large to fit at all, rendering it useless over your basin.
Silicone vs. Stainless Steel: Gripping Power Matters
Consider the material of the rack’s ends. While stainless steel offers durability, racks with full silicone wrapping, like the MERRYBOX model, provide superior grip on your sink edges. This prevents frustrating slips and slides during use, whether you’re drying dishes or using it as a prep surface.
Ensure the silicone is FDA food-grade safe as indicated for products like the HANZENMA, for peace of mind during food handling and washing.

What to Look For in a Roll Up Sink Drying Rack
Material and durability
Prioritize stainless steel for unmatched durability and rust resistance, ensuring your drying rack withstands constant moisture without degrading. Silicone-coated or entirely silicone racks offer excellent grip and flexibility for easy storage, but check the steel rod count and gauge; more, thicker rods mean superior weight bearing. Look for a rack with at least 15-18 stainless steel rods for significant load support.
For maximum longevity and strength, choose a fully stainless steel construction. This guarantees a rust-proof, easy-to-clean surface that won’t warp, making it the definitive choice for heavy-duty use.
Size and fit
Select a rack length that precisely matches your sink for optimal functionality, typically between 17 and 21 inches. A universal design will accommodate most standard kitchen sinks, but measure your sink’s internal dimensions beforehand. The key is ensuring the rack extends sufficiently over the basin without protruding awkwardly.
Wider racks offer more drying space, an advantage for larger households or those who wash many dishes at once. Aim for racks with ample spacing between rods to allow for efficient air circulation and quicker drying of various dishware sizes.
The ideal fit is a rack that sits securely and fully spans your sink.
Weight capacity and support
Evaluate the weight capacity to ensure it handles your typical dish load, especially heavy pots and pans. Look for racks with a stated weight limit of at least 20 pounds; anything less risks bending or failure. A well-constructed rack will feature robust, non-slip feet and thick stainless steel rods capable of distributing weight evenly, preventing sagging even with a full complement of wet dishes.
Racks with a solid frame and closely spaced rods provide the best stability. Choose a rack with a high weight capacity and sturdy build for reliable support of all your kitchenware.

Frequently Asked Questions
What Are The Main Benefits Of A Roll Up Sink Drying Rack?
A roll up sink drying rack offers significant kitchen space-saving benefits by utilizing vertical drying space over the sink. It keeps countertops clear and allows dishes to dry efficiently, making post-meal cleanup more manageable.
How Do I Ensure A Roll Up Sink Drying Rack Fits My Sink?
To ensure a proper fit, measure the length of your sink basin or the countertop space directly above it. Most roll up racks are designed to accommodate standard kitchen sink sizes, but checking the specific dimensions is crucial before purchasing.
What Materials Are Common For Roll Up Sink Drying Racks?
Common materials for roll up sink drying racks include stainless steel for the rods and BPA-free silicone for the edging. This combination provides durability, rust resistance, and a non-slip grip that protects your sink.
Can A Roll Up Sink Drying Rack Hold Heavy Items?
Yes, many roll up sink drying racks are designed to hold substantial weight, often supporting items like heavy pots, pans, and multiple plates. Always check the product’s stated weight capacity to ensure it meets your needs.
How Do I Clean And Maintain My Roll Up Sink Drying Rack?
Cleaning is typically simple; most racks can be washed with soap and water or placed in the dishwasher. Regular rinsing and drying will prevent water spots and maintain the material’s integrity, ensuring its longevity.
